The exterior of the Overlook Hotel in Stanley Kubrick's The Shining (1980) was filmed at the Timberline Lodge on Mount Hood in Oregon.

Filming Details

Interiors were constructed and shot at Elstree Studios in England, with design inspiration from the Ahwahnee Hotel in Yosemite National Park, California. The film's opening helicopter shots of Jack Torrance's car winding through mountains occurred along Going-to-the-Sun Road in Glacier National Park, Montana.

Real-World Inspiration

Stephen King's novel drew from the Stanley Hotel in Estes Park, Colorado, but Kubrick did not film there. The Timberline Lodge remains a ski resort and tourist draw for fans, though it lacks the movie's infamous hedge maze, which was a studio build.
